Metal roofing is becoming increasingly well-liked for both residential and commercial structures due to its sturdiness, longevity, and aesthetic enchantment. Within the category of metal roofing, there are several forms of materials, every providing unique advantages and traits. Understanding the assorted types can help householders and builders in making informed decisions primarily based on their particular needs.


Steel is certainly one of the mostly used metal roofing materials. Known for its energy and affordability, metal roofs can stand up to excessive climatic conditions, making them a dependable choice. They are sometimes coated with zinc to stop rust and corrosion, which reinforces their durability. Additionally, metal roofs are lightweight, reducing the structural load on buildings.


Aluminum is one other in style option, particularly in coastal areas where corrosion from saltwater is a concern. Aluminum roofing is naturally immune to rust, making it a superb alternative for areas exposed to harsh components. Although it's usually dearer than metal, its light-weight quality allows for simple installation, which may offset a variety of the costs. Aluminum also has a definite reflective high quality that can help in energy conservation.


Copper roofing has a singular aesthetic attraction, often related to historic buildings and high-end properties. Over time, copper develops a patina that not only enhances its look but additionally serves as a protective layer towards corrosion. Its longevity is exceptional, often lasting over fifty years, making it a powerful funding. However, the preliminary cost of copper roofing is significantly larger than different metal options, limiting its use primarily to premium projects.

Zinc roofing is yet one more alternative that offers distinctive sturdiness and resistance to corrosion. Like copper, zinc develops a protecting patina over time, which can give it a particular look and enhance its lifespan. Zinc roofing is known for its eco-friendliness, as it normally accommodates a excessive share of recycled materials (Insulation Options During Tile To Metal Roof Replacement In Sydney). The installation of zinc requires specialized methods, as the fabric can be more difficult to work with in comparison with steel or aluminum


Corrugated metal roofs are widely known for their ribbed design, which provides each visible interest and strength. The corrugation supplies structural integrity whereas permitting for efficient water drainage. Typically created from steel or aluminum, these roofs are light-weight and cost-effective. Their commercial applications are common, but they can be utilized in residences to attain a country or industrial look.

Standing seam metal roofing is characterised by its vertical seams that create a sleek and trendy look. This kind of roofing is usually produced from metal or aluminum and may be put in in longer panels, decreasing the variety of seams that might be susceptible to leakages. The raised seams additionally add to its sturdiness, making it a preferred selection in regions with heavy snowfall or rainfall. The installation course of, however, could be more labor-intensive, which can improve costs.


Metal shingles present a versatile option for these in search of the appearance of traditional roofing materials with the added benefits of metal. These shingles can mimic the look of wooden, slate, or tile whereas delivering the durability and longevity of metal. Typically out there in steel or aluminum, metal shingles provide various kinds and colors that may complement any architectural design. While the initial installation cost could also be larger, the low maintenance requirements and long life can provide financial savings over time.

Galvalume is a popular metal roofing material that consists of metal coated with aluminum and zinc. This combination provides excellent corrosion resistance and is understood for its long-lasting properties. Galvalume roofs additionally reflect warmth, which can contribute to energy efficiency in buildings. The material is light-weight and could be installed with ease, making it a practical selection for builders and householders alike.

Each type of metal roofing material comes with its own set of professionals and cons, significantly influenced by the environment during which they are put in. For instance, areas with heavy rainfall may get pleasure from standing seam roofing due to its capacity to shed water effectively. Coastal areas, however, may discover aluminum or zinc to be more sturdy options against corrosion.


Cost issues additionally play a significant function in the selection course of. While metal roofing is usually costlier than conventional materials like asphalt shingles, the long-term benefits usually justify the initial funding (Durability Of Metal Roofs Compared To Tile Roofs In Sydney). Factors such as longevity, reduced maintenance needs, and energy efficiency can result in substantial savings over the lifetime of the roof

Understanding the insulation and energy efficiency potential of metal roofing materials is equally necessary. Many metal roofs are designed with reflective coatings that can reduce warmth absorption, leading to decrease energy bills in hotter climates. Proper installation techniques also can enhance insulation, creating a more energy-efficient structure that can contribute to overall savings.


In terms of maintenance, metal roofs require minimal consideration when in comparison with different roofing materials. Regular inspections and cleansing are sometimes enough to keep metal roofs in optimum condition. This low maintenance requirement could make metal roofing an appealing choice for busy householders on the lookout for a long-lasting and hassle-free solution.
